Introduced in House· May 7, 20130

Home School Equity Act for Tax Relief of 2013 - Amends the Internal Revenue Code to: (1) extend through 2013 the tax deduction for expenses of elementary and secondary school teachers, and (2) expand the definition of "school" for purposes of such tax deduction to include a home school which provides elementary or secondary education if such school is treated as a home school or private school under state law.
